Solution for 2(10x-6)=x+7 equation:



2(10x-6)=x+7
We move all terms to the left:
2(10x-6)-(x+7)=0
We multiply parentheses
20x-(x+7)-12=0
We get rid of parentheses
20x-x-7-12=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
19x-19=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
19x=19
x=19/19
x=1
